Looking for Information on Robert William Chesterfield

My great Uncle ROBERT WILLIAM CHESTERFIELD was born in Baddiginni Victoria in 1885. He moved to Beaudesert Queensland with his parents and two brothers in 1892. After his mother died in 1906 he moved to Victoria and joined the Navy in 1907. He met Mary Caroline Saunderson in Tasmania and they were married 24 February 1911 in Hobart. She had an illegitimate son Charles Saunderson born in 1904. On 23 February 1916 Robert enlisted in the AIF in Goulburn NSW. His address at this time was Colo Vale NSW and his next of kin was his brother George. During the War, his wife lodged a claim for maintenance for herself and her son Charles. She told the Army that he had abandoned her and could be using another name e.g. his mother's maiden name "Curran". This was acknowledged by the War Effort and his wife was sent money from his wages and she was then listed as his next of kin. After serving overseas, Robert returned to Australia in July 1919 and returned to his Naval position as far as we know. His younger brother (my grandfather) would have nothing to do with him when he found out he had left his wife in Tasmania. The story goes that he met another woman and had a few daughters to her but was never married. All attempts to find his death have failed. However, he was last heard of living in Maryborough Victoria quite some time ago. We have not been able to find his name on electoral rolls. Could anyone let me know if you know what happened to him.
